Content: The Committee considered a report from planning officers, together with an addendum circulated prior to the meeting in relation to a full application for the construction of a new building over the existing yard to allow HGVs to be loaded under cover.   A planning officer presented details of the application with the aid of various maps, plans and photographs.   The Committee were informed that the Coal Authority had now responded to the consultation and had not raised any objections to the proposed development and therefore the recommendation was to grant permission.   Members of the Committee asked questions of the officers and made comments.  In doing so the Committee gave consideration to:  ·       The principle of the development ·       Potential impact on amenity ·       Impact on character and appearance ·       Impact on highway safety ·       Biodiversity   Based on the considerations of the Committee the Chair proposed acceptance of the officers recommendation, including an additional condition relating to the management and monitoring of the landscaping and wildlife scheme.  On being put to the vote 9 members voted for the recommendation with 0 votes against.   RESOLVED – That planning permission be granted subject to the conditions as set out within the officer’s report   (Reason for the Decision: The Committee concluded that having regard to relevant policies contain in the Local Plan and National Planning Policy Framework the proposed development was acceptable).
